Hyderabad: The TRS Legal Cell thanked Chief Justice of India NV Ramana for his approval to increase the bench strength of the High Court of Telangana from 24 to 42.

In a statement, the Legal Cell said the combined High Court of Andhra Pradesh and Telangana had a strength of 61 judges on the date of bifurcation. The TS High Court came into effect on January 1, 2019, with an allotted strength of 24 judges, and the number of cases pending as on the said date was 1.87 lakh cases.


On February 13, first Chief Justice of TS HC Justice TB Radha Krishnan wrote to the Union Law Minister requesting an increase in the bench strength in view of the backlog cases. Chief Minister K Chandrashekhar Rao also wrote to Prime Minister Narendra Modi requesting him to expedite the proposal.
